Dr. Christine Chan

Christine makes her impact by advising global institutions on sustainability and climate change risks. She has expertise in green bond development, ecosystem restoration, climate adaptation policies in developing countries, and sustainability risks in lending and investment portfolios. Engaging with Lumi Voce allows her to connect with future generations on critical issues like biodiversity and habitat protection. Since learning to kayak and paddle board, she has paddled her way across 500km of Hong Kong ocean waters. 

Christine completed her PhD in Oceanography (University of Rhode Island), and her MBA in Strategy (HEC Paris).  She began her career as a NASA Global Change Fellow, and has continued to advocate for environmental issues. She is an active volunteer working to empower young women and girls as they prepare for challenging careers in Hong Kong.
